The commission voted 6–5 to deny a request to rezone about 38.6 acres for exterior storage and related industrial uses, citing proximity to residences and environmental concerns.

The San Antonio Zoning Commission voted 6–5 to deny a request to rezone roughly 38.6 acres that an applicant sought to use for exterior storage of large vehicles and related commercial activity.
